摘要
Many automation tasks require human intervention and guidance. A control system architecture combining work units and master units by software interfaces is described. OSCAR(1) is incorporated as a universal transform service. It is regarding dynamic properties of work units. Implementing the transform at the master site eases integration of new robot types. The dynamic behaviour when crossing singular points is compared with a closed form standard transform. The control system has also been applied in medical manipulator systems.
